The GrowMind controller compensates for sensor drift in its humidity and CO2 probes using a rolling baseline recalibration every six hours. Reviewers should note that drift correction values are written to the device's local config partition without signature verification, which was flagged during the Fernhollow audit cycle. The compensation algorithm, its threat assumptions, and the history of calibration-related incidents are documented in detail by the Verdana Systems firmware team. The full internal write-up can be found here:

runbook for badug-kadup: https://confluence.zemvarlabs.internal/projects/browse/display/projects/bd1b

Subject: Handover — VramScope release duties

Hey, taking over VramScope releases from me starting next sprint — lucky you. The GPU memory profiler itself is stable; the tooling around it is where the dragons live. Watch the allocator-trace exporter, it breaks whenever the driver shim changes. Review queue etiquette: sign off on the packaging diff before tagging, not after. Everything you publish must be signed with the deploy key below.

deploy key for kajof-fajop: bky6_gDHw9Q

All backfill job definitions require a two-stage approval: a peer review in the Driftgate console and a final sign-off recorded in this wiki. Jobs touching retention-scoped tables additionally require compliance review. Approval records are retained for twelve months and exported quarterly for audit. Questions about scope or exceptions should be directed to the named owner. The approver of record for Nightfill is listed below.

account owner for bawip-tahag: Raleth Quenok

Subject: On-call heads-up — Orchardly catalog cache. Welcome aboard. The main gotcha: catalog price updates invalidate by SKU, but bundle pages cache composite keys, so a stale bundle can outlive its parts. If support reports wrong bundle prices, purge the composite namespace first. We'll cover this at the weekly sync; the invalidation playbook is on this internal page.

wiki page, yagef-tawif: https://sentry.lumicdata.local/view/merge_requests/pipeline/merge_requests/e08f7f35c80b5755